#e12234 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e12234 is composed of 88.2% red, 13.3%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.9%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 354.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 50.8%. #e12234 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4468 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e12234 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e12234 has RGB values of R:225, G:34,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.77,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14754356.

Shades and Tints of #e12234
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e12234
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a797b is the less saturated color, while #fe051c is the most saturated one.
